DTC : P0589-15 (2016 2017 2018)

DTC P0589-15  : Main Switch Signal Circuit Open

NOTE:  Before you troubleshoot, review the general troubleshooting information - Go to: How to Troubleshoot the Adaptive Cruise Control (ACC) (2016 2017 2018) .

  1. Problem verification

    - 1. Turn the vehicle to the ON mode.

    - 2. Clear the DTC with the HDS.

    Clear DTCs

    - 3. Turn the vehicle to the OFF (LOCK) mode.

    - 4. Turn the vehicle to the ON mode, then wait for at least 5 seconds.

    - 5. Check for DTCs with the HDS.

    Is DTC P0589-15 indicated?

    YES 

    The failure is duplicated. Go to step 2.

    NO 

    Intermittent failure, the system is OK at this time. Go to intermittent failures troubleshooting - Refer to: How to Troubleshoot the Adaptive Cruise Control (ACC) (2016 2017 2018) . If the freeze data/on-board snapshot of this DTC is recorded, try to reproduce the failure under the same conditions with the Freeze data/on-board snapshot.

  2. Open wire check (CRUISE SW line) 1

    - 1. Turn the vehicle to the OFF (LOCK) mode.

    - 2. Disconnect the following connector.

    ACC combination switch 12P connector

    - 3. Turn the vehicle to the ON mode.

    - 4. Measure the voltage between test points 1 and 2.

    Test condition Vehicle ON mode
    ACC combination switch 12P connector: disconnected
    Test point 1 ACC combination switch 12P connector No. 2
    Test point 2 Body ground
    GHH311087Courtesy of HONDA, U.S.A., INC.

    Is there about 5 V?

    YES 

    The CRUISE SW wire is not open. Go to step 3.

    NO 

    Go to step 7.

  3. ACC combination switch internal circuit check

    - 1. Measure the voltage between test points 1 and 2.

    Test condition Vehicle ON mode
    ACC combination switch 12P connector: disconnected
    Test point 1 ACC combination switch 12P connector No. 2
    Test point 2 ACC combination switch 12P connector No. 5
    GHH311088Courtesy of HONDA, U.S.A., INC.

    Is there about 5 V?

    YES 

    Replace the ACC Combination Switch (2016 2017 20018) .

    NO 

    Go to step 4.

  4. Open wire check (DISTANCE SW GND line) 1

    - 1. Check for continuity between test points 1 and 2 without disconnect the cable reel connector C (20P).

    Test condition Vehicle OFF (LOCK) mode
    ACC combination switch 12P connector: disconnected
    Test point 1 Cable reel connector C (20P) No. 16
    Test point 2 Body ground
    GHH311089Courtesy of HONDA, U.S.A., INC.

    Is there continuity?

    YES 

    Repair an open in the wire between the ACC combination switch and the cable reel.

    NO 

    Go to step 5.

  5. Open wire check (DISTANCE SW GND line) 2

    - 1. Check for continuity between test points 1 and 2 without disconnect the cable reel connector A (20P).

    Test condition Vehicle OFF (LOCK) mode
    ACC combination switch 12P connector: disconnected
    Test point 1 Cable reel connector A (20P) No. 4
    Test point 2 Body ground
    GHH311090Courtesy of HONDA, U.S.A., INC.

    Is there continuity?

    YES 

    Replace the Cable Reel .

    NO 

    Go to step 6.

  6. Open wire check (CRUISE SW GND line) 4

    - 1. Disconnect the following connector.

    Cable reel connector A (20P)
    Gauge control module 32P connector

    - 2. Check for continuity between test points 1 and 2 without disconnect the gauge control module connector A (32P).

    Test condition Vehicle OFF (LOCK) mode
    Cable reel connector A (20P) : disconnected
    Gauge control module 32P connector: disconnected
    ACC combination switch 12P connector: disconnected
    Test point 1 Gauge control module 32P connector No. 20 - Refer to:
    Gauge Control Module Connector for Inputs and Outputs (2016 2017 2018)
    Test point 2 Cable reel connector A (20P) No. 4
    GHH311091Courtesy of HONDA, U.S.A., INC.

    Is there continuity?

    YES 

    The DISTANCE SW GND wire is not open. Replace the Gauge Control Module .

    NO 

    Repair an open in the wire between the gauge control module and the cable reel.

  7. Open wire check (CRUISE SW line) 2

    - 1. Measure the voltage between test points 1 and 2 without disconnect the cable reel connector C (20P).

    Test condition Vehicle ON mode
    ACC combination switch 12P connector: disconnected
    Test point 1 Cable reel connector C (20P) No. 15
    Test point 2 Body ground
    GHH311092Courtesy of HONDA, U.S.A., INC.

    Is there about 5 V?

    YES 

    Repair an open in the wire between the ACC combination switch and the cable reel.

    NO 

    Go to step 8.

  8. Open wire check (CRUISE SW line) 3

    - 1. Measure the voltage between test points 1 and 2 without disconnect the cable reel connector A (20P).

    Test condition Vehicle ON mode
    ACC combination switch 12P connector: disconnected
    Test point 1 Cable reel connector A (20P) No. 3
    Test point 2 Body ground
    GHH311093Courtesy of HONDA, U.S.A., INC.

    Is there about 5 V?

    YES 

    Replace the Cable Reel .

    NO 

    Go to step 9.

  9. Open wire check (CRUISE SW line) 4

    - 1. Turn the vehicle to the OFF (LOCK) mode.

    - 2. Disconnect the following connector.

    Cable reel connector A (20P)
    Gauge control module 32P connector

    - 3. Measure the voltage between test points 1 and 2 without disconnect the gauge control module connector A (32P).

    Test condition Vehicle OFF (LOCK) mode
    Cable reel connector A (20P) : disconnected
    Gauge control module 32P connector: disconnected
    ACC combination switch 12P connector: disconnected
    Test point 1 Gauge control module 32P connector No. 30 - Refer to:
    Gauge Control Module Connector for Inputs and Outputs (2016 2017 2018)
    Test point 2 Cable reel connector A (20P) No. 3
    GHH311094Courtesy of HONDA, U.S.A., INC.

    Is there continuity?

    YES 

    The CRUISE SW wire is not open. Replace the Gauge Control Module .

    NO 

    Repair an open in the wire between the gauge control module and the cable reel.
